February 17, 2023 - The San Bernardino National Forest (SBNF) Front Country Ranger District will be conducting a prescribed pile burn today from 10:00 am to 5:00 pm weather and environmental conditions allowed. There is approximately 10 acres of burning planned. This will be occurring in the Angelus Oaks Community near the north of unit 5. Residents and visitors will see flames and smoke visible throughout the day and evening. Firefighters will be monitoring the area until all piles are extinguished.
Prescribed fire plays an important role in forest health and reducing extreme wildfires and their negative impact. These fires also help reduce heavy fuel loads while simultaneously opening the conifer forest structure and maintaining the health of meadow habitats. Fire is also used to enhance native plant communities and cultural landscapes and improve wildlife habitats. Another goal is to provide defensible space for communities and developed areas within and surrounding the SBNF. With all fire comes smoke, the U.S. Forest Service work to mitigate smoke impacts from prescribed fires on the communities in the area.
